2使用C3P0

可以使用配置文件,也可以不使用配置文件

不使用配置文件:

package com.itheima.c3p0;

import java.sql.Connection;
import java.sql.PreparedStatement;
import java.sql.SQLException;

import org.apache.commons.dbcp.BasicDataSource;
import org.junit.Test;

import com.itheima.uitl.JDBCUtil;
import com.mchange.v2.c3p0.ComboPooledDataSource;

public class C3P0Demo {

	@Test
	public void testC3P0 (){
		
		
		
		Connection conn = null;
		PreparedStatement ps = null;
		try {
			//1. 創建datasource
//			ComboPooledDataSource dataSource = new ComboPooledDataSource("oracle");
			
			//默認會找 xml 中的 default-config 分支。 
			ComboPooledDataSource dataSource = new ComboPooledDataSource();
			System.out.println(dataSource.hashCode() );
			ComboPooledDataSource dataSource2 = new ComboPooledDataSource();
			System.out.println(dataSource2.hashCode()+"-------");
			//2. 設置連接數據的信息
			dataSource.setDriverClass("com.mysql.jdbc.Driver");
			
			//忘記了---> 去以前的代碼 ---> jdbc的文檔
			dataSource.setJdbcUrl("jdbc:mysql://localhost/bank");
			dataSource.setUser("root");
			dataSource.setPassword("root");
			
			//2. 得到連接對象
			conn = dataSource.getConnection();
			String sql = "insert into account values(null , ? , ?)";
			ps = conn.prepareStatement(sql);
			ps.setString(1, "admi234n");
			ps.setInt(2, 103200);
			
			ps.executeUpdate();
			
		} catch (Exception e) {
			e.printStackTrace();
		}finally {
			JDBCUtil.release(conn, ps);
		}
	}
}

使用配置文件: 

<?xml version="1.0" encoding="UTF-8"?>
<c3p0-config>

	<!-- default-config 默認的配置,  -->
  <default-config>
    <property name="driverClass">com.mysql.jdbc.Driver</property>
    <property name="jdbcUrl">jdbc:mysql://localhost/bank</property>
    <property name="user">root</property>
    <property name="password">root</property>
    
    
    <property name="initialPoolSize">10</property>
    <property name="maxIdleTime">30</property>
    <property name="maxPoolSize">100</property>
    <property name="minPoolSize">10</property>
    <property name="maxStatements">200</property>
  </default-config>
  
   <!-- This app is massive! -->
  <named-config name="oracle"> 
    <property name="acquireIncrement">50</property>
    <property name="initialPoolSize">100</property>
    <property name="minPoolSize">50</property>
    <property name="maxPoolSize">1000</property>

    <!-- intergalactoApp adopts a different approach to configuring statement caching -->
    <property name="maxStatements">0</property> 
    <property name="maxStatementsPerConnection">5</property>

    <!-- he's important, but there's only one of him -->
    <user-overrides user="master-of-the-universe"> 
      <property name="acquireIncrement">1</property>
      <property name="initialPoolSize">1</property>
      <property name="minPoolSize">1</property>
      <property name="maxPoolSize">5</property>
      <property name="maxStatementsPerConnection">50</property>
    </user-overrides>
  </named-config>

 
</c3p0-config>
	
package com.itheima.c3p0;

import java.sql.Connection;
import java.sql.PreparedStatement;

import org.junit.Test;

import com.itheima.uitl.JDBCUtil;
import com.mchange.v2.c3p0.ComboPooledDataSource;

public class C3P0Demo02 {

	@Test
	public void testC3P0(){
		Connection conn = null;
		PreparedStatement ps = null;
		try {
			
			//就new了一個對象。
			ComboPooledDataSource dataSource = new ComboPooledDataSource();
			
			//2. 得到連接對象
			conn = dataSource.getConnection();
			String sql = "insert into account values(null , ? , ?)";
			ps = conn.prepareStatement(sql);
			ps.setString(1, "wangwu2");
			ps.setInt(2, 2600);
			
			ps.executeUpdate();
			
		} catch (Exception e) {
			e.printStackTrace();
		}finally {
			JDBCUtil.release(conn, ps);
		}
	}
}

使用配置文件:

 

#連接設置
driverClassName=com.mysql.jdbc.Driver
url=jdbc:mysql://localhost:3306/bank
username=root
password=root

#<!-- 初始化連接 -->
initialSize=10

#最大連接數量
maxActive=50

#<!-- 最大空閒連接 -->
maxIdle=20

#<!-- 最小空閒連接 -->
minIdle=5

#<!-- 超時等待時間以毫秒爲單位 6000毫秒/1000等於60秒 -->
maxWait=60000


#JDBC驅動建立連接時附帶的連接屬性屬性的格式必須爲這樣:[屬性名=property;] 
#注意:"user" 與 "password" 兩個屬性會被明確地傳遞,因此這裏不需要包含他們。
connectionProperties=useUnicode=true;characterEncoding=gbk

#指定由連接池所創建的連接的自動提交(auto-commit)狀態。
defaultAutoCommit=true

#driver default 指定由連接池所創建的連接的事務級別(TransactionIsolation)。
#可用值爲下列之一:(詳情可見javadoc。)NONE,READ_UNCOMMITTED, READ_COMMITTED, REPEATABLE_READ, SERIALIZABLE
defaultTransactionIsolation=READ_UNCOMMITTED

DBUtils主要的作用是幫助我們方便的執行sql語句。

package com.itheima.domain;

public class Account {

	private String name02;
	private int money;
	public int getMoney() {
		return money;
	}
	public void setMoney(int money) {
		this.money = money;
	}
	public String getName02() {
		return name02;
	}
	public void setName02(String name02) {
		this.name02 = name02;
	}
	@Override
	public String toString() {
		return "Account [name02=" + name02 + ", money=" + money + "]";
	}
	
	
}
package com.itheima.dbutils;

import java.sql.ResultSet;
import java.sql.SQLException;
import java.util.List;

import org.apache.commons.dbutils.QueryRunner;
import org.apache.commons.dbutils.ResultSetHandler;
import org.apache.commons.dbutils.handlers.BeanHandler;
import org.apache.commons.dbutils.handlers.BeanListHandler;
import org.junit.Test;

import com.itheima.domain.Account;
import com.mchange.v2.c3p0.ComboPooledDataSource;

/*
//針對增加  、 刪除 、 修改
queryRunner.update(sql)

//針對查詢
queryRunner.query(sql, rsh);*/
public class TestDBUtils {

	
	@Test
	public void testInsert() throws SQLException, InstantiationException, IllegalAccessException{
		
//		ComboPooledDataSource dataSource = new ComboPooledDataSource();
		
		//dbutils 只是幫我們簡化了CRUD 的代碼, 但是連接的創建以及獲取工作。 不在他的考慮範圍
		QueryRunner queryRunner = new QueryRunner(new ComboPooledDataSource());
	
		
		//增加
		//queryRunner.update("insert into account values (null , ? , ? )", "aa" ,1000);
		
		//刪除
//		queryRunner.update("delete from account where id = ?", 5);
		
		//更新
		//queryRunner.update("update account set money = ? where id = ?", 10000000 , 6);
		
		
		//去執行查詢,查詢到的數據還是在哪個result裏面。 然後調用下面的handle方法,由用戶手動去封裝。
		/*Account  account =  queryRunner.query("select * from account where id = ?", new ResultSetHandler<Account>(){

			@Override
			public Account handle(ResultSet rs) throws SQLException {
				Account account  =  new Account();
				while(rs.next()){
					String name = rs.getString("name");
					int money = rs.getInt("money");
					
					account.setName(name);
					account.setMoney(money);
				}
				return account;
			}
			 
		 }, 6);
		
		System.out.println(account.toString());
		*/
		
		
		// 通過類的字節碼得到該類的實例
		
/*		
		Account a = new Account();
		
		//創建一個類的實例。
		Account a1=  Account.class.newInstance();
		*/
		
		
		//查詢單個對象
		Account account = queryRunner.query("select * from account where id = ?", 
				new BeanHandler<Account>(Account.class), 8);
		System.out.println(account.toString());
		
		/*List<Account> list = queryRunner.query("select * from account ",
				new BeanListHandler<Account>(Account.class));
		
		for (Account account : list) {
			System.out.println(account.toString());
		}*/
	}
}
